Public Speaking Professor Job Description

Job Brief

The Public Speaking Professor will deliver engaging courses in communications, focusing on public speaking, organizational communication, public relations, radio/television broadcasting, and journalism. This role requires a passionate educator with a strong background in communication principles and methodologies. The ideal candidate will possess a blend of teaching experience and research capabilities, fostering an interactive and supportive learning environment for students at various academic levels.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and deliver curriculum for public speaking and communication courses, ensuring alignment with industry standards.
  • Engage students through innovative teaching methods, including lectures, workshops, and practical demonstrations.
  • Assess student performance through assignments, presentations, and examinations, providing constructive feedback.
  • Conduct research in the field of communications, contributing to academic publications and conferences.
  • Advise and mentor students, guiding them in academic and career development.
  • Collaborate with faculty and staff to enhance departmental offerings and improve student outcomes.
  • Stay updated on trends in communication and public speaking, integrating new techniques into the curriculum.

Requirements

  • Master’s degree or higher in Communication, Public Relations,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in teaching public speaking or communications courses at the college level.
  • Strong knowledge of communication theories, public relations strategies, and media practices.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to engage diverse audiences.
  • Demonstrated research skills, with a record of publications or conference presentations.
  • Familiarity with digital media tools and educational technologies used in the communication field.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a multidisciplinary environment and contribute to departmental growth.
